Croquet Victoria Open Singles Golf Croquet Championship for 2026
Australia Day saw the finals of the “Croquet Victoria Open Singles Golf Croquet Championship for 2026” played at the Victorian Croquet Centre from 24th Jan till 26th Jan. Competition was of a really high standard and the final was an amazing Best of 3 match between Felix Gelman White (Williamstown) and Richard Hingst (Williamstown). Felix was the victor over Richard 4/7 7/2 7/5. Third placegetters were Lachlan Berryman and Jack Williams. The Plate was won by Alister McDougal from Boort who remained unbeaten in all 5 games he played.

Weather proved a large factor and added interest to the tournament- Day 1 was an early finish due to heat and Day 2 proved to be heavy with smoke from bushfires which only cleared around 11am. A big thankyou to all the players who dealt with the adversity without complaint and continued to play on as conditions allowed. Many players were called back for an early start on the Sunday due to the early cease of play on Saturday and did this without complaint.
Courts were in great condition and running very fast so challenging the players skill set.
